Long Beach, NY Apartments for Rent

Long Beach is an oceanfront city on a barrier island off Long Island's South Shore, with a beautifully restored 2.2-mile boardwalk that runs along the Atlantic Ocean. Nicknamed "The City by the Sea," this compact community was incorporated in 1922 and still showcases its original Mediterranean-style architecture from its early planning days. If you're looking for apartments for rent in Long Beach, you'll discover everything from oceanfront apartment communities to converted beach bungalows in the West End, with one-bedroom places averaging around $2,955.

Renting in Long Beach means coastal living with an easy commute to Manhattan - the Long Island Rail Road gets you to Penn Station in under an hour. The city's two main shopping strips, Park Avenue and West Beech Street, are packed with restaurants, surf shops, and local boutiques, all within walking distance of most apartments. You can spend your days on the 3.5-mile white sand beach, catch free summer concerts, or check out annual events like the Arts and Crafts Festival and the Long Beach International Film Festival. The city runs buses 24/7 on five routes, so you can get around without a car, though parking permits are available if you need one.
